9 This list does not have "reply to munging" enabled, meaning the Reply-To
10 will not be set to the list address for you.
11
12 On some reasons why that often is a good idea, read the
13 article "Reply-To Munging Considered Harmful" [1].
14
15 Please use the "Reply to all" or "Reply to list" features of your
16 mailer, they all have either of those if not both. Please do not use
17 forwarding.
18
19 Also, you could write some procmail rule (if applicable) to reset the
20 Reply-To for your incoming mail, see [2] for details.
